The eyes can become red because of dryness issues. We don’t blink as often or as completely when we stare at screens. Even if the eyes don’t feel dry, the tear film is likely becoming unstable. Which causes inflammation on the eye and causes redness. It’s important to take frequent breaks from devices. Also using artificial tears. Otherwise definitely ask your local doctor what they think and if there is anything else they think would help.
